2. The Foundations of Egyptian Mathematics and Cosmology

a. Basic Principles of Egyptian Numeracy and Calculations

Egyptians utilized a decimal system with hieroglyphic symbols representing units, tens, hundreds, and beyond. Their calculations often employed simple addition and subtraction, but they also developed methods for more complex operations, such as multiplication and division, evident in their papyri like the Rhind Mathematical Papyrus (circa 1650 BCE). This document reveals their understanding of fractions, algebraic concepts, and problem-solving techniques that predate Greek mathematicians.

3. The Eye of Horus: An Ancient Symbol of Protection and Knowledge

a. Historical Origins and Mythological Significance

The Eye of Horus originates from Egyptian mythology, symbolizing protection, royal power, and good health. According to myth, Horus lost his eye in a battle with Set, and it was restored by Hathor, representing healing and wholeness. This myth encapsulates themes of restoration, divine insight, and protection—concepts that resonate in both spiritual and practical contexts.

b. The Eye as a Mathematical and Protective Emblem

Mathematically, the Eye of Horus was used as a fractional notation system, where different parts of the eye represented fractions such as 1/2, 1/4, 1/8, etc. This innovative approach allowed ancient Egyptians to perform complex calculations related to measurements and offerings. The symbol’s protective qualities extended into amulets and charms, believed to ward off evil and ensure safety.

4. Technological Innovations in Ancient Egypt and Their Educational Value

a. Water Clocks (Clepsydras): Measuring Time with High Precision

Egyptians invented water clocks, or clepsydras, around 1500 BCE to measure time intervals more accurately than sundials. These devices used regulated water flow to mark passing hours, demonstrating an understanding of fluid dynamics and precise timing—principles foundational to modern chronometry.
